Poor Louise Redknapp has been sent love and support from her celeb pals as it’s confirmed she’s lost her West End job.

The Strictly Come Dancing star was hospitalised after a dramatic and nasty fall, with her friend, Love Island star Amber Davies wishing her a “speedy recovery.”

(Credit: louiseredknapp Instagram
Louise fell over on her way to rehearsals (Credit: louiseredknapp Instagram)

Taking to Instagram, Louise – who was due to play Violet Newstead in the new Dolly Parton musical 9-5 – shared a selfie showing her awful injury.

She wrote beside it: “It breaks my heart 💔to say I am having to take some time out and won’t be able to continue with my role in 9-5. Due to a nasty fall I have only gone and fractured my wrist and got 10 (yes 10) stitches in my chin. 🤕.”

The 44-year-old mum-of-two went on: “Following my doctors orders- they have said I will be ok but as they say in the theatre 🎭 ‘the show must go on’ and I wish the rest of the fabulous cast an amazing opening night and I will be back on that stage for 9-5 before you know it. 💔😢💔.”
